WebSo, fast stimulating music stimulates the production of adrenaline and other hormones that get your heart racing faster and your pulse increases and blood pressure increases and then soothing, relaxing music has the opposite effect. The interesting thing here is that what I am calling stimulating or relaxing music is relative. WebMar 3, 2024 · Music makes life better in so many ways. WebApr 23, 2024 · Participants performed four musical tasks as music activities – listening, singing, rhythm tapping, and keyboard playing – in addition to a non-musical task. In order to examine music-induced arousal, the arousal level of each participant was measured before and after the musical task. WebFeb 16, 2024 · In recent years, scientific studies have confirmed the connection between music and mood. Some studies have found that listening to music you enjoy may increase the release of pleasure-causing substances in the brain like norepinephrine and melatonin. It may also decrease stress-causing hormone production in the body.
